Manjua Forest - Mirik, Darjeeling
Manjua Forest is a village situated in the Mirik subdivision of Darjeeling district, West Bengal. It is located approximately 9 km from Mirik.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Manjua Forest is 306403. The village covers a total geographical area of 663.69 hectares and falls under the 734423 pincode. Mirik is the nearest town, located about 16 km away.
Manjua Forest village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system.
Population of Manjua Forest
As per Census 2011, Manjua Forest village has a total population of 143 people, consisting of 80 males and 63 females. The village has 31 households and a sex ratio of 787 females per 1,000 males. There are 7 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 99 literate and 44 illiterate residents. Additionally, 58 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Manjua Forest are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 143 | 80 | 63 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 7 | 5 | 2 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 58 | 32 | 26 |
| Literate Population | 99 | 56 | 43 |
| Illiterate Population | 44 | 24 | 20 |

Transport and Connectivity of Manjua Forest
Manjua Forest is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ared van services. The nearest railway station is Gayabari, while the nearest airport is Bagdogra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 17.9 km.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Mirik to Manjua Forest is about 16 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
